Where does the ozone hole occur? |
North pole South pole The arctic Stratosphere |
South pole |
The correct answer is option 2. South pole. The South Pole experienced ozone hole, known as ozone layer depletion in the 1980s. Chlorine sinks are created in the summer when NO2 and CH4 interact with chlorine atoms and chlorine monoxide, avoiding significant ozone depletion. Polar stratospheric clouds, a unique type of cloud, develop above Antarctica throughout the winter. |
